Understanding the Fundamentals: Essential Skills for Firewall Logging and Auditing

To excel in firewall logging and auditing, security professionals need to possess a combination of technical, analytical, and problem-solving skills. These include a deep understanding of network protocols, firewall configurations, and logging mechanisms, as well as the ability to analyze log data, identify patterns, and detect anomalies. Additionally, professionals should be familiar with regulatory requirements, such as PCI-DSS, HIPAA, and GDPR, and understand how to implement logging and auditing practices that meet these standards. By mastering these essential skills, security professionals can effectively monitor network activity, identify potential security threats, and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ements.

Best Practices for Effective Firewall Logging and Auditing

Implementing best practices for firewall logging and auditing is critical to maximizing network visibility and detecting potential security breaches. This includes configuring firewalls to log relevant data, such as source and destination IP addresses, ports, and protocols, as well as implementing logging mechanisms that can handle large volumes of data. Security professionals should also establish a centralized logging system, use log analysis tools to identify patterns and anomalies, and regularly review and update logging configurations to ensure they remain effective. Furthermore, organizations should implement a security information and event management (SIEM) system to collect, monitor, and analyze log data from multiple sources, providing a comprehensive view of network activity.
